Establishing Visual Hierarchy in Blog Posts and Article Layouts

Effective editorial design relies on a clear visual hierarchy to keep readers engaged, and Love Honey serves as an excellent tool for breaking up long-form content with stylistic flair. By using this Script Handwritten typeface for section dividers, chapter openers, or blockquote attributions, you introduce a rhythmic change in texture that prevents the page from feeling monotonous. In a blog post discussing travel experiences or personal stories, dropping a large initial cap styled in Love Honey at the start of the article sets a narrative tone that invites the reader into a story rather than just presenting information. It is important, however, to remember that while Love Honey is beautiful, it is a display font meant for emphasis rather than body copy. Pairing it with a highly readable serif font for the main text ensures that the reading experience remains comfortable and accessible, while the script font acts as the "jewelry" of the layout—adding sparkle and personality without overwhelming the content.

Pairing Love Honey with Complementary Typefaces for Professional Results

To get the most out of Love Honey, understanding how to pair it with other Fonts is essential for creating balanced and professional editorial layouts. A classic approach involves contrasting the organic, flowing lines of this Script Handwritten font with a structured, modern sans serif like Montserrat or Lato for captions and navigation elements. This juxtaposition highlights the unique character of Love Honey while grounding the design in functionality. Alternatively, pairing it with a traditional serif font can enhance the vintage or romantic vibe, ideal for wedding guides or historical fiction ebooks. Experimenting with font weights and sizes allows you to fine-tune the relationship between the headline and the body text, ensuring that the romantic feel of Love Honey enhances the message rather than distracting from it.
